How to import a canva presentation to Google Slides

Canva is a great tool for creating visually appealing presentations, but sometimes you may need to edit or share your design in Google Slides.
Thankfully, importing your Canva presentation into Google Slides is easy.
In this guide, I’ll show you how to seamlessly transfer your Canva presentation to Google Slides in just a few simple steps.

How to Import a Canva Presentation to Google Slides: A Step-by-Step Guide

Step 1: Open Your Canva Presentation

Start by opening Canva and navigating to the presentation you want to import into Google Slides.
Make any final edits or adjustments to your design before exporting the file.

Step 2: Download the Presentation from Canva

Once your presentation is ready, click the "Share" button in the top-right corner of the screen, then select "Download" from the dropdown menu.
In the download options, choose "Microsoft PowerPoint (.pptx)" as the file format.
This is important because Google Slides can easily import PowerPoint files. After selecting the format, click "Download."

Step 3: Open Google Slides

Now, go to Google Slides and sign in to your account.
Once you're on the homepage, click on the "Blank" presentation or any existing presentation if you wish to import the Canva presentation into it.

Step 4: Import the Canva Presentation

In Google Slides, click on "File" in the top-left corner, and from the dropdown menu, select "Import Slides."
This will open a pop-up window. Choose the "Upload" tab and click on "Select a file from your device."
Find the downloaded Canva PowerPoint file (.pptx) and upload it.

Step 5: Choose Slides to Import

After the upload is complete, Google Slides will show a preview of all the slides in the presentation.
You can choose to import all slides or select specific ones by clicking on them.
Once you've made your selections, click "Import slides" to finalize the process.

Step 6: Edit and Customize in Google Slides

Now that your Canva presentation has been imported, you can make additional edits and adjustments using Google Slides' editing tools.
Customize the text, images, or layout as needed, and save your changes.

FAQs can come handy!

Will the design elements from Canva stay intact when imported into Google Slides?

Most design elements will remain intact, but some minor adjustments may be needed due to differences in platforms.

Can I edit images and fonts after importing to Google Slides?

Yes, once the presentation is imported into Google Slides, you can edit text, images, and fonts just like in a regular Google Slides presentation.

Can I directly import a Canva presentation without downloading as a PowerPoint file first?

No, you must first download your Canva presentation as a PowerPoint (.pptx) file before importing it to Google Slides.
